Eleven members completes the Motorcyclist & Defensive Driving Training Program.

The SSamoa Police, Prisons & Corrections Services(SPPCS) is proud to announce the successful completion of a highly-anticipated motorcycle training program. After weeks of hard work and dedication, 11 SPPCS members have now become qualified motorcyclists.
The 11 graduates consist of a diverse group of officers, with 10 men and 1 woman representing the department. The female officer, in particular, received well-deserved accolades for her commendable effort and unwavering commitment to becoming a motorcyclist.
This accomplishment marks the second class conducted by SPPCS’ motorcyclist & defensive driving instructors, who have recently obtained their certificates of being qualified instructors. Their expertise and dedication to the training process have played a significant role in the successful outcome of this program.
